  • Abstract
    We suggest a communication method for severely disabled persons, who have lost both mobility and speech, and their family using Morse code derived by Masseter muscle EMG. We developed a portable system that comprises EMG amplifier, A/D conversion, text-to-speech module, remote control module and serial communication to the host system. After training, the patient can make speech by composing Morse code by moving his/her chin. Calibration and remote control mode is supported. It also supports the adaptive encoding method for fatigue
